Karamba is one of the most welcoming clubs in Phoenix. There is a quiet patio outside and two bar areas inside. The first bar is a smaller more intimate room. It is wonderful for mixing and meeting new people or just watching the guests pass by. The larger room which is a dance and show area has a very festive atmosphere that puts everyone in the mood to dance or watch the shows. The FEMALE ILLUSIONISTS who star in these shows are just exceptional. They have the polish and class of the golden days of Drag Shows when QUEENS really were QUEENS! They also have big screen televisions in both rooms with video feeds that keep the atmosphere festive. But, if all that wasn't enough this club also has DJs in the old school tradition skilled at mixing it up and making everyone feel good. If you like to party, to really leave everything behind and let loose this is your place. You won't find a nicer staff, better bartenders or more fun anywhere in Phoenix.
